László Dubrovay, who explores the possibilities afforded by wind instruments and who likes pushing the limits of instrumental playing, has written numerous compositions for exceptionally talented musicians. His new Bassoon Concerto will be performed by György Lakatos, who is equally at home in many musical styles and is also committed to promoting the cause of new music. This time, he will showcase not only his virtuosity but also the different sides and shades of his personality. The concert will feature popular pieces such as Kodály’s Variations on a Hungarian Folksong “The Peacock” and Richard Strauss’ Der Rosenkavalier Suite. The conductor at this evening performance, László Kovács is one of the most dedicated interpreters of Leó Weiner’s art and has already made recordings of many of his works, including the Divertimento No. 3.
